In a significant move to monetize the next generation of web browsing, Opera has officially launched public early access for its AI-powered browser, Neon. Priced at a premium USD 19.90 per month, Neon promises a deeply integrated, agentic AI experience but arrives amidst growing cybersecurity warnings about the very technology it champions. This launch places Opera in direct competition with other AI-first browsers like Perplexity's Comet and OpenAI's Atlas, signaling a pivotal shift in how companies envision our future interaction with the web.
A Premium AI-Powered Workspace
Opera Neon is positioned not as a simple browser upgrade but as an "agentic workspace." Its core functionality revolves around four specialized AI agents deeply woven into the browsing experience. The 'Chat' agent functions as a conventional chatbot for queries and conversations. More ambitiously, the 'Neon Do' agent can autonomously navigate the internet to research topics and compile findings directly into documents like Google Docs. For creators, 'Neon Make' serves as a studio for generating code, applications, images, and videos. Finally, the 'ODRA' agent is designed for deep research, capable of breaking down complex subjects into structured, exportable reports.

The High Cost of Cutting-Edge AI
The subscription fee of USD 19.90 (approximately CNY 140.8) is a stark departure from the free-to-use model of traditional browsers. Opera justifies this cost by bundling access to several high-end, typically paid AI models, including Google's Gemini 3 Pro, OpenAI's GPT-5.1, Veo 3.1, and Nano Banana Pro. The company emphasizes that Neon is for users who want to be on the bleeding edge, with Krystian Kolondra, Opera's browser business executive vice president, stating the project will see "major changes" every week. Subscribers also gain access to a dedicated Discord community for direct interaction with the development team.
Inherent Security Risks and Industry Warnings
The launch comes at a time of heightened scrutiny for AI browsers. Just a week prior, analyst firm Gartner recommended that companies block employee use of such browsers due to unique security vulnerabilities. The primary concern is a novel threat called "indirect prompt injection." Because AI agents can autonomously interact with web content, they could be tricked by malicious code on a webpage into ignoring their safety protocols. This could lead to the agent divulging sensitive user data from its context—like browsing history or open tabs—or performing unauthorized actions.
The UK's National Cyber Security Centre reinforced these concerns, noting there is a "good chance prompt injection will never be properly mitigated" and that systems must be designed to tolerate the residual risk. Opera has already faced this issue; in October, security researchers alerted the company to a specific prompt-injection vulnerability in Neon, which Opera says it has since patched.

The Competitive Landscape and Future Outlook
Neon enters a nascent but competitive market. It goes beyond the AI features being added to mainstream browsers like Chrome and Edge by building the entire interface around autonomous AI agents. Its "Tasks" feature, which groups AI conversations and related tabs into workspaces, echoes functionality seen in browsers like Arc. The industry is actively seeking solutions to the security dilemma, with Google recently proposing a "User Alignment Critic"—a separate AI model designed to vet an agent's plans before execution.
For now, the message from security experts is clear: while the capabilities of AI browsers like Opera Neon are impressive, the associated risks are significant and not yet fully solved.
